Which school has higher graduate earnings, Salon Success Academy-West Covina or American Beauty College?▼
Salon Success Academy-West Covina graduates earn more at 10 years out, with a median of $26,956 vs $22,481. Source: U.S. Department of Education College Scorecard.
Which school is more affordable, Salon Success Academy-West Covina or American Beauty College?▼
Based on average net price (after grants and scholarships), Salon Success Academy-West Covina is the more affordable option at $17,928 per year versus $25,781.
